Why do multiple accounts get banned?
Multiple accounts get banned because platforms use anti-fraud systems to detect when several accounts share the same traits and tie them to a single user.
Every time you connect, your browser exposes a set of parameters: operating system, screen resolution, fonts, graphics card, time zone, language, canvas, WebGL, and more. Together these form a near-unique fingerprint. If five accounts share the same fingerprint and the same IP, the platform has strong grounds to conclude one person controls them all — and that's when bulk bans happen.
In other words, accounts aren't banned because you have many — they're banned because the accounts look the same. The entire craft of safe multi-account management is making each account look like a real, independent user.

Mistake 1: Reusing the same browser fingerprint
This is the most serious mistake: logging into many accounts in the same browser usually makes them share one fingerprint, and they get linked almost instantly.
A regular browser (default Chrome or Firefox) doesn't create a different fingerprint per account. Even if you log out, clear cookies, or use incognito mode, the hardware and configuration parameters stay the same. To an anti-fraud system, five accounts with one fingerprint equal one person.
How to avoid it:
● Keep each account in its own profile, and give each profile a distinct fingerprint (different canvas, WebGL, fonts, time zone, and so on).
● Use an antidetect browser to create and manage these profiles instead of hand-tweaking settings — manual edits easily miss parameters and leak.

Mistake 2: Sharing one IP or using poor-quality proxies
Sharing one IP across accounts, or using free proxies that are already flagged, is the fastest way to get linked even when your fingerprints are separated.
Fingerprint and IP are two independent signals. You can separate fingerprints perfectly and still get caught if ten accounts exit through one home IP. Free proxies are worse: they're often shared by thousands of users and already on blocklists, so they flag accounts the moment you log in.
How to avoid it:
● Assign each profile its own stable proxy in the geographic region you want to emulate.
● Prefer residential or mobile proxies for sensitive platforms; use datacenter proxies for lower-risk work.
● Avoid free proxies, and don't constantly rotate the IP of a single account — erratic IP jumps are themselves an anomaly.
Mistake 3: Running bulk actions too fast
Logging in, posting, adding friends, or messaging in bulk over a short window makes behavior look robotic, and this is one of the most common ban triggers.
Even with clean fingerprints and IPs, behavior gives you away. Humans don't create 50 accounts in an hour, post 200 times in ten minutes, or act with second-perfect precision. Anti-fraud systems watch speed and rhythm to detect crude automation.
How to avoid it:
● Space out actions, add randomized delays between steps, and work at a human-like pace.
● Don't log into every account at once from the same machine within a few minutes.
● If you use automation, cap the number of actions per account per day and simulate natural behavior.
Mistake 4: Skipping account warm-up
A brand-new account pushed into heavy activity immediately looks suspicious; skipping the warm-up stage is a mistake that kills accounts early.
A real account usually starts slowly: a few logins, a profile update, some browsing, light interaction, and only then a gradual ramp-up. An account that runs ads, spams messages, or sells right after creation stands out — the wrong way. "Warming up" simply gives the account time to look like a normal user.
How to avoid it:
● Give each new account a few days to a few weeks: complete the profile, log in regularly, interact lightly.
● Increase activity gradually instead of running at full capacity on day one.
● Keep each account in its own profile throughout warm-up so its history stays consistent.
Mistake 5: Not backing up cookies and sessions
Not backing up cookies and login sessions means one lost profile or machine failure wipes your logged-in state and can force re-verification — which raises ban risk.
Cookies and sessions store each account's "logged-in" state. If they disappear, you have to log in from scratch, sometimes triggering an identity check, and every re-login is a moment the system scrutinizes you. Mass re-logins in a short window are themselves an anomaly.
How to avoid it:
● Back up cookies and profile data regularly and store them safely.
● Use a profile manager that can sync or back up so you don't depend on a single machine.
● Don't clear cookies carelessly between sessions — they're part of the account's trusted history.
Mistake 6: Messy profile management
No naming, no labels, and no organization leads to acting on the wrong account — cross-posting, wrong logins, or wrong proxies — and these slips cause bans too.
When profiles reach the dozens or hundreds, memory isn't enough. Posting account A's content on account B, attaching the wrong proxy, or accidentally running two accounts on one configuration are human errors with the same consequence as technical ones: accounts get linked and banned.
How to avoid it:
● Name profiles by a clear convention (platform - purpose - number) and use labels or groups.
● Record each account's proxy, creation date, and warm-up status in one central place.
● Use multi-account management software with a central dashboard to prevent mix-ups.
Mistake 7: Ignoring platform rules
Managing multiple accounts for legitimate work is normal, but using many accounts to spam, defraud, or evade rules will get caught no matter how good your setup is.
An antidetect browser is a neutral tool: agencies managing client accounts, sellers with many stores, and QA and security teams all use it legitimately. But the tool doesn't turn abuse into compliance. If the goal is mass spam or fraud, platforms detect it through user reports, content patterns, and behavioral signals — hiding a fingerprint won't save you.
How to avoid it:
● Define a clear legitimate purpose: multi-store, multi-client, testing, or security work.
● Read and respect each platform's terms; avoid clearly prohibited behavior.
● Treat fingerprint/IP separation as protecting privacy and separating work — not as a way to cheat.
A safe multi-account workflow
A safe workflow has four steps: create isolated profiles, assign dedicated proxies, warm accounts up slowly, then operate with regular backups.
A four-step workflow for safe multi-account management: create separate profiles, assign proxies, warm up, then operate with backups.
1. Create profile: one profile per account, each with an independent fingerprint.
2. Assign proxy: one stable, region-correct IP per profile.
3. Warm up: act slowly and naturally, ramp up gradually, avoid bulk actions.
4. Operate: back up cookies, monitor account health, and scale steadily.

Frequently asked questions (FAQ)
Can running multiple accounts on one device get you banned?
It can, if the accounts share a fingerprint, share an IP, or act too fast. When each account has its own profile, fingerprint, and proxy and behaves naturally, the ban risk drops considerably — though nothing is guaranteed.
Does an antidetect browser prevent account bans?
An antidetect browser isolates each profile's fingerprint so accounts aren't linked, which is one important half. The other half is operating habits: good proxies, warm-up, slow actions, and following platform rules.
Does each account need its own proxy?
For sensitive platforms, it should. Sharing one IP across accounts is one of the strongest linking signals; a dedicated, stable proxy per profile is much safer.
How long does account warm-up take?
There's no fixed number; usually a few days to a few weeks depending on the platform and risk level. The principle is to start slowly, complete the profile, interact lightly, and ramp up gradually instead of running at full capacity.
